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/m-anwar-hussaini/greeting-back-end
https://github.com/m-anwar-hussaini/greeting-back-end
Last synced: 28 days ago
JSON representation
- Host: GitHub
- URL: https://github.com/m-anwar-hussaini/greeting-back-end
- Owner: M-Anwar-Hussaini
- License: mit
- Created: 2024-02-12T16:45:38.000Z (9 months ago)
- Default Branch: develop
- Last Pushed: 2024-02-13T18:32:45.000Z (9 months ago)
- Last Synced: 2024-02-14T06:28:53.925Z (9 months ago)
- Language: Ruby
- Size: 34.2 KB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
Greeting-Back_End
# 📗 Table of Contents
- [📗 Table of Contents](#-table-of-contents)
- [📖 hello\_rails\_front\_end ](#-hello_rails_back_end-)
- [💻 link to front end ](#-link-to-front-end-)
- [🛠 Built With ](#-built-with-)
- [Tech Stack ](#tech-stack-)
- [Key Features ](#key-features-)
- [💻 Getting Started ](#-getting-started-)
- [Prerequisites](#prerequisites)
- [Setup](#setup)
- [Install](#install)
- [Usage](#usage)
- [👥 Author ](#-author-)
- [🔭 Future Features ](#-future-features-)
- [🤝 Contributing ](#-contributing-)
- [⭐️ Show your support ](#️-show-your-support-)
- [🙏 Acknowledgments ](#-acknowledgments-)
- [📝 License ](#-license-)**Greeting-Back-ENd** Introducing 'hello-react-back-end,' a straightforward React-Redux application. It employs a
primary App component with react-router for seamless navigation. A designated route directs users to the Greeting
component, showcasing dynamic greeting messages retrieved from an external API. The application leverages Redux for
efficient state management, focusing on handling API requests and dynamically updating the displayed greeting message.[Link to Front End](https://github.com/M-Anwar-Hussaini/Greeting-Front-End)
Technologies
Linters
- Rubocop
- [x] **Integration of Ruby on Rails and React**
- [x] **API Endpoint for Generating Random Greetings**
- [x] **Navigation Using React Router**
- [x] **State Management with Redux**
- [x] **Setting the Static View as the Root**
To get a local copy up and running, follow these steps.
### Prerequisites
Before you begin, make sure you have the following prerequisites installed on your system:
- Ruby: You need Ruby to run the Ruby on Rails application.
- Bundler: Bundler is used to manage gem dependencies in your Ruby project.
### Setup
Clone this repository to your desired folder:
sh
cd my-folder
git clone https://github.com/M-Anwar-Hussaini/Greeting-Back-End.git
### Install
Install this project with:
- npm install
- npm start
### Usage
To run the project, execute the following command:
rails server
**Anwar Hussaini 🙋♂️**
- Github: [@Anwar Hussaini](https://github.com/M-Anwar-Hussaini/)
- [ ] **Personalized Greetings**
Contributions, issues, and feature requests are welcome!
Feel free to check the [issues page](https://github.com/M-Anwar-Hussaini/Greeting-Back-End/issues).
If you like this project please feel free to send me corrections for make it better I would feel glad to read your
comments.
And think If you enjoy gift me a star.
- Microverse for providing the opportunity to learn Git and GitHub in a collaborative environment.
This project is licensed under the MIT License - you can click here to have more details [MIT](./LICENSE) licensed.